Furniture Finisher applies finishes, such as stain, lacquer, paint, oil and varnish, to furniture, and polishes and waxes finished furniture surfaces.
Futures Trader buys and sells commodity futures on behalf of clients. Registration or licensing is required.
Gallery or Museum Curator plans and organises a gallery or museum collection by drafting collection policies and arranging acquisitions of pieces.
Gallery or Museum Technician repares artworks, specimens and artefacts for collections, and arranges and constructs gallery or museum exhibits.
Gardener plants, cultivates and maintains parks and gardens.
Gas or Petroleum Operator perates equipment to pump oil and gas from wellheads, and refine and process petroleum products.
Gasfitter installs, maintains and repairs gas mains, piping systems downstream of the billing meter, and appliances and ancillary equipment associated with the use of fuel gases, including liquefied petroleum gas systems. Registration or licensing is required.
Gastroenterologist diagnoses and treats diseases of the liver, stomach and associated organs.
General Practitioner diagnoses, treats and prevents human physical and mental disorders and injuries. Registration or licensing is required.
Geologist studies the composition, structure and other physical attributes of the earth to increase scientific knowledge and to develop practical applications in fields such as mineral exploitation, civil engineering, environmental protection and rehabilitation of land after mining.
